我已经使用 selenium webdriver 准备了一个测试框架。
它使用 testng 生成测试结果。
现在,当我运行 Build.xml 文件时,它显示构建成功,但是当尝试执行构建时它失败并显示一个 msg 它不包含主类。
之后我在我的项目中添加了一个主类,它可以工作并且我能够执行 jar 文件。
问题是只有主类被执行,而不是整个项目。
为了解决它,我在主类中添加了所有类的实例并且它起作用了。
但我的主要问题是测试结果。它没有使用 Testng 生成测试结果。
谁能帮我吗?
我已经使用 selenium webdriver 准备了一个测试框架。
它使用 testng 生成测试结果。
现在,当我运行 Build.xml 文件时,它显示构建成功,但是当尝试执行构建时它失败并显示一个 msg 它不包含主类。
之后我在我的项目中添加了一个主类,它可以工作并且我能够执行 jar 文件。
问题是只有主类被执行,而不是整个项目。
为了解决它,我在主类中添加了所有类的实例并且它起作用了。
但我的主要问题是测试结果。它没有使用 Testng 生成测试结果。
谁能帮我吗?
假设您正在使用 ant,请查看以下内容,它应该可以让您很好地了解您需要做什么
http://openwritings.net/public/testng/ant-build-file-testng
当然,这只是为了运行 testng,在此之前,我建议您在 build.xml 文件中清理并编译所有类。
这也是使用 testng 编译和运行程序的 build.xml 的一个很好的示例
http://www.seleniumtests.com/2011/06/selenium-tutorial-ant-build-for.html